Real Madrid picked up a vital win at mid-week in the first leg of the Copa del Rey semifinals, scoring a professional 1-0 victory over Real Sociedad at the Anoeta. This weekend, Real Madrid will, once again, have to hit the road to face another one of LaLiga's better sides in Real Betis.

The Verdiblancos currently occupy seventh in the top division and now boast two of the best players in the league in a healthy Isco, a former Real Madrid star, and Antony, who has been on fire with a goal contribution per game since joining on loan from Manchester United.

Madridistas know full well not to expect a victory at the Benito Villamarin, and they certainly won't take a win for granted this weekend when one of their most important players won't be playing, in addition to the suspended Jude Bellingham.

Fede Valverde would miss three games in a row

According to a report from COPE's Melchor Ruiz, Uruguayan central midfielder Fede Valverde is a "serious doubt" for Saturday's game with a hamstring injury. Additionally, MARCA currently do not have the 26-year-old in the projected lineup against Betis, meaning, barring a huge surprise, Madridistas can safely expect to see someone else starting in the midfield or at right back.

Fede missed the last two matches against Girona and Real Sociedad, both clean sheet victories, with injuries, so Real Madrid are absolutely capable of winning without him. But since Fede is the best available option at right back or as a box-to-box midfielder, losing the all-action engine of the team is a big blow. Plus, Valverde has gone back to scoring bangers from outside the box regularly, and losing that trump card at the Villamarin will also hurt.

Valverde has been one of the most-utilized players in LaLiga this season with 24 starts and over 2,100 minutes, so it's rare for him to miss a game. With Atletico Madrid on the horizon in the Champions League, Real Madrid can't afford to take any risks with Fede, so the most cautious approach to ensure the team leader is available for a Champions League knockout derby is, by far, the most prudent course of action.

In those minutes, Valverde has scored five goals with three assists and over three combined tackles and interceptions per game. Real Madrid will likely start Luka Modric and Eduardo Camavinga as 8's in Fede's place with Lucas Vazquez moving back into the starting lineup at right back so that Aurelien Tchouameni and Raul Asencio can play in their preferred positions in the defensive midfield and at center back, respectively.

Dani Ceballos just suffered an injury of his own in the late minutes of the La Real win, so he won't be ready to battle his former club.
